The 18th G20 Summit will be hosted by India in New Delhi on September 9-10. The world leaders and delegates attending the summit will be treated to Indian street food and millet dishes, showcasing the country's cuisine and climate-resistant grains. The leaders will also plant saplings of national plants as part of creating a G20 Garden. The spouses of the world leaders will have a chance to explore India's rich handicrafts legacy and enjoy a shopping experience. Special attention is being given to choosing gifts that represent India's handicraft traditions and culture.
